Course Overview

Course Overview This rigorous Interior Design degree focuses on the human experience of space, teaching you to create meaningful and innovative interventions within existing architectural environments. You will learn to shape environments, generate identities, and detail objects through a synthesis of creative ideas and practical resolution. The course places a strong emphasis on how people interact with their surroundings, from large architectural scales to the design of specific surfaces and materials. Key Program Highlights Learn from a faculty of practising designers and architects with expertise across interior architecture, exhibition, and set design. Engage in regular live industry projects with major brands like The Design Council, McCann Erickson, and Pret A Manger. Participate in international study trips to design capitals such as New York, Berlin, Rotterdam, and Venice. Collaborate with other creative disciplines through the innovative, external-facing Unit X project. Gain global perspective with opportunities for student exchanges in Australia, Canada, the USA, and Europe.
